abdhiḥ [āpaḥ dhīyante atra, dhā-ki] 1 The ocean, receptacle of water; (fig. also) duḥkha˚, kārya˚, jñāna˚ &c.; store or reservoir of anything. -2 A pond, lake. -3 (In Math.) A symbolical expression for the number 7; sometimes for 4. -Comp. -agniḥ the sub- marine fire. -kaphaḥ, -phena: 1 froth, foam. -2 the cuttle-fish bone, being regarded as the froth of the ocean. -jaa. born in the ocean. (-jaḥ) 1 the moon. -2 The conch. -jam Salt. (-jau) (dual) N. of the Aśvins. (-jā) 1 spirituous liquor (produced from the ocean). -2 the Goddess Lakṣmī. -jhaṣaḥ a sea-fish. -ḍiṇḍiraḥ froth, foam. -dvīpā 1 the earth. 2 a portion of land surrounded by the ocean. -nagarī N. of Dwārakā, the capital of Kṛiṣṇa. -navanītakaḥ 1 the moon (the butter of the ocean). -maṇḍūkī the pearl-oyster. -śayanaḥ N. of Viṣṇu (so called from his resting in the ocean at the destruction and renovation of the world). -sāraḥ a gem.
